1. Budget-Chic Scandinavian Spa With Warm Accents

Item 1

The mood is calm, clean, and cozy all at once. Think airy neutrals with warm wooden touches that keep it from feeling clinical.

Color palette leans into soft whites, light grays, and honey-toned wood. The space breathes, and you’ll notice how simple, thoughtful touches make all the difference.

Color Palette

  • Off-white walls
  • Warm oak or ash cabinetry
  • Blush or sage accents

Key Pieces

  • Floating vanity with a light wood finish
  • Minimalist white porcelain sink
  • Woven basket storage and a linen shower curtain

Styling Tips

  • Add a fluffy white rug and a few potted greens for life
  • Choose matte brass or black hardware to add subtle contrast
  • Keep countertop clutter to a minimum with clever organizers

Vibe: serene, airy, and effortlessly put-together. This is the bathroom you’d want after a long day—calm, clean, and comforting. Ideal for small spaces where you still crave a spa-like feel.

4. Bold Monochrome With a Pop of Color

Item 4

High-contrast glam that still feels intimate. This design plays with a strong, unified color story and one bright punch.

Pick a color you love and go full throttle—then break the monotony with a single, daring accent.

Color Palette

  • Charcoal or deep navy walls
  • White fixtures and cabinetry for contrast
  • One bright accent (turquoise, coral, or lime)

Key Pieces

  • Matte-black or brass fixtures
  • Glossy tile in a coordinating shade
  • Statement mirror with a bold frame

Styling Tips

  • Limit patterns to one area to avoid visual chaos
  • Introduce one glossy surface to reflect light and keep the room from feeling heavy

Vibe: confident and chic. This is for the design daredevil who loves a room that looks intentional and a little theatrical. Trust me, it’s easier than it sounds to pull off.
